Not Doing Enough Research


My third big regret was skipping thorough research before purchasing. I’d get so excited about finding a feather-sleeve blazer that I’d impulsively click "buy" without vetting the brand or examining product details. That impatience cost me both money and considerable frustration.


I learned the hard way that a bit of homework pays off. I should have checked the fabric composition and searched for reviews about how the feathers were attached. Did they stay put? Did they look cheap up close? I used to simply trust the brand, assuming they’d offer good quality—a mistake I won’t make again.


Consider this: walking into a store with rude staff and long checkout lines is what happens when you don’t check a retailer’s reputation. Had I known about poor service or inconvenient policies, I would have shopped elsewhere. Similarly, neglecting product research means you might end up with something ill-fitting, uncomfortable, or prone to falling apart. It’s like walking in blind.


Here’s what I now do:



  • Check fabric content: Will it wrinkle easily, or is it breathable?
  • Consult sizing charts: Does the brand run small or large?
  • Read multiple reviews: Look for consistent feedback, not just the first few comments.
  • Find real customer photos: These show how items look on everyday people, not just models.

Verdict: Always do your research! Don’t rush into a purchase. Read reviews, scrutinize product details, and look for authentic buyer photos to avoid disappointment.
